Queclink GL530MG — LTE Cat M1 Waterproof Asset Tracker with 7-Year Battery and Environmental Monitoring
The Queclink GL530MG is the LTE Cat M1 and NB2 upgrade of Queclink's proven GL500MG — an easy-to-deploy waterproof asset tracker built on Queclink's innovative power management technology that delivers up to 7 years of standby time, one of the longest battery lives of any device of its size on the market. By upgrading to LTE Cat M1 and NB2 with 2G fallback via Queclink's unique single antenna solution, the GL530MG covers a broader range of global networks than its predecessor — making it more flexible and future-proof for international deployments across the UK and worldwide.
What sets the GL530MG apart from standard LTE asset trackers is its combination of built-in environmental sensors alongside GPS location.
The internal temperature sensor enables cold chain and cargo condition monitoring without any additional accessories. The built-in light sensor detects when packaging or a housing is opened and exposed to light — providing immediate tamper alerts for concealed cargo. Together these sensors give the GL530MG genuine environmental intelligence alongside location tracking, making it suitable for a much wider range of monitoring applications than standard GPS-only asset trackers.

Technical Specifications
Cellular: LTE Cat M1 and NB2 with 2G GPRS fallback
GNSS: u-blox All-in-One — GPS, GLONASS, Galileo, BeiDou — less than 2.5m CEP accuracy
Battery: 1,400mAh — up to 7 years standby at 1 report per day with GNSS on
Sensors: Temperature, ambient light, 3-axis accelerometer
Waterproofing: IP67
Dimensions: 87 x 51 x 30mm — 87 x 51 x 33.5mm with magnetic case Mounting: Clip-on design — optional magnetic case
Operating temperature: -40°C to +85°C

Does the GL530MG monitor temperature without additional sensors?
Yes — the GL530MG has a built-in internal temperature sensor for basic cold chain and cargo condition monitoring straight out of the box, with no additional accessories required.
What does the light sensor do?
The built-in light sensor detects when packaging, a container or a housing is opened and exposed to light, triggering an immediate tamper alert — particularly valuable for monitoring concealed cargo where unauthorised access during transit must be detected instantly.
